- Conduct thorough underwriting analysis for multifamily mortgage loans to ensure compliance with company guidelines and industry standards.
- Review financial statements, rent rolls, and other relevant documentation to evaluate the creditworthiness of potential borrowers.
- Collaborate with internal teams to gather and analyze market data, property information, and borrower financials to assess risk and make informed investment decisions.
- Communicate effectively with borrowers, lenders, and other stakeholders to gather necessary information and provide updates on loan status.
- Utilize industry knowledge and expertise to identify potential risks and make recommendations for risk mitigation strategies.
- Maintain a strong understanding of commercial real estate finance principles and industry trends to inform underwriting decisions.
- Adhere to all regulatory and compliance requirements while performing underwriting duties.
- Provide support and guidance to junior underwriters and other team members as needed.
- Continuously monitor and evaluate loan performance to identify potential issues and propose solutions.

Federal Home Loan Mortgage Corp. provides liquidity, stability and affordability to the U.S. housing market primarily by providing credit guarantee for residential mortgages originated by mortgage lenders and investing in mortgage loans and mortgage-related securities.
